Hyper-V中键盘失灵,解决方案来了!

hyper v 键盘不管用

时间:2025-01-06 21:05


Hyper-V 键盘无响应问题:深度解析与终极解决方案 在虚拟化技术日益普及的今天,Hyper-V 作为微软 Windows 系统中内置的虚拟化平台,为企业和个人用户提供了强大的虚拟化解决方案

    然而,在使用 Hyper-V 的过程中,部分用户遇到了一个令人头疼的问题——键盘在虚拟机中无响应

    这个问题不仅影响了用户的工作效率,更在某种程度上降低了对 Hyper-V 平台的信任度

    本文将深入剖析这一问题,提供多种可能的解决方案,并探讨其背后的原因,力求为用户提供一个全面、有力的解决方案

     一、Hyper-V 键盘无响应现象概述 Hyper-V 键盘无响应的现象通常表现为:在启动或运行虚拟机时,用户无法通过键盘进行任何输入操作,无论是文本输入还是快捷键操作,均无法得到有效响应

    该问题可能出现在不同类型的虚拟机操作系统中,包括但不限于 Windows、Linux 等

    同时,该现象并不完全受限于特定的硬件或软件环境,因此具有相当的普遍性和复杂性

     二、问题成因分析 Hyper-V 键盘无响应的问题可能由多种因素导致,以下是对其可能成因的详细分析: 1.驱动程序不兼容: - 虚拟机中安装的操作系统可能缺少对 Hyper-V 增强型会话模式(Enhanced Session Mode,ESM)的支持,或者其内置的驱动程序与 Hyper-V 平台存在不兼容问题

     - 主机操作系统或 Hyper-V 平台的更新可能导致原有的驱动程序失效,从而产生键盘无响应的问题

     2.增强型会话模式设置问题: - 增强型会话模式(ESM)是 Hyper-V 提供的一种功能,允许用户通过虚拟机控制台进行更丰富的交互操作,包括音频、视频、剪贴板共享以及键盘和鼠标输入

    然而,如果 ESM 设置不当或未正确启用,可能导致键盘输入无法传递至虚拟机

     - 某些情况下,ESM 可能因为虚拟机配置文件的损坏或丢失而无法正常工作

     3.虚拟硬件配置问题: - 虚拟机的键盘控制器或 USB 控制器配置错误可能导致键盘无法被正确识别和使用

     - 虚拟机的 BIOS/UEFI 设置中可能禁用了对键盘的支持或设置了错误的键盘类型

     4.主机操作系统与 Hyper-V 交互问题: - 主机操作系统的某些安全设置或软件(如防火墙、杀毒软件)可能阻止了 Hyper-V 与虚拟机之间的正常通信,导致键盘输入无法传递

     - 主机操作系统的更新或补丁安装可能影响了 Hyper-V 的正常工作,从而产生键盘无响应的问题

     5.其他因素: - 虚拟机内部软件的故障或冲突也可能导致键盘无响应

     - 虚拟机的网络连接问题(如虚拟交换机配置错误)可能间接影响键盘输入功能的正常工作

     三、解决方案与实践 针对 Hyper-V 键盘无响应的问题,以下提供了一系列可能的解决方案,用户可根据自身情况选择适用的方法进行尝试: 1.检查并更新驱动程序: - 确保虚拟机中安装的操作系统支持 Hyper-V 增强型会话模式,并检查是否有可用的驱动程序更新

     - 在主机操作系统中,检查 Hyper-V 的集成服务组件是否已安装并更新到最新版本

     2.启用并配置增强型会话模式: - 在 Hyper-V 管理器中,确保已启用增强型会话模式,并检查其配置是否正确

     - 如果虚拟机配置文件损坏或丢失,尝试重新创建虚拟机配置文件以恢复 ESM 功能

     3.检查并调整虚拟硬件配置: - 在 Hyper-V 管理器中,检查虚拟机的键盘控制器和 USB 控制器配置,确保它们已正确设置并启用

     - 进入虚拟机的 BIOS/UEFI 设置,检查键盘支持选项是否已启用,并设置正确的键盘类型

     4.调整主机操作系统设置: - 检查主机操作系统的安全设置和软件配置,确保它们不会阻止 Hyper-V 与虚拟机之间的正常通信

     - 暂时禁用防火墙或杀毒软件,以排除它们对 Hyper-V 工作的影响

     - 检查主机操作系统的更新历史记录,了解是否有任何可能影响 Hyper-V 工作的更新或补丁,并考虑回滚这些更新或补丁

     5.重启 Hyper-V 服务: - 在主机操作系统中,尝试重启 Hyper-V 服务以恢复其正常工作状态

     - 重启后,检查虚拟机中的键盘输入功能是否恢复正常

     6.创建新的虚拟机并迁移数据: - 如果上述方法均无法解决问题,考虑创建一个新的虚拟机,并将原始虚拟机中的数据迁移到新虚拟机中

     - 在新虚拟机中,确保正确配置增强型会话模式和其他相关设置,以避免键盘无响应的问题再次发生

     7.联系技术支持: - 如果问题仍然无法解决,建议联系微软技术支持或访问相关技术论坛寻求帮助

     - 提供详细的问题描述、系统配置信息以及已尝试的解决方案,以便技术支持人员能够更快地定位问题并提供有效的解决方案

     四、预防措施与未来展望 为了避免 Hyper-V 键盘无响应的问题再次发生,用户可以采取以下预防措施: 1.定期更新驱动程序和系统补丁: - 确保虚拟机中安装的操作系统和 Hyper-V 平台都保持最新状态,以减少因驱动程序不兼容或系统漏洞导致的问题

     2.备份虚拟机配置文件: - 定期备份虚拟机的配置文件和数据,以便在出现问题时能够快速恢复

     3.谨慎配置虚拟硬件: - 在创建或配置虚拟机时,仔细检查虚拟硬件的配置设置,确保它们符合操作系统的要求和预期的使用场景

     4.监控与日志记录: - 启用 Hyper-V 的日志记录功能,以便在出现问题时能够迅速定位并解决问题

     - 定期检查系统日志和 Hyper-V 日志,以发现潜在的故障迹象并采取预防措施

     展望未来,随着虚拟化技术的不断发展和完善,Hyper-V 平台也将不断优化和改进其功能和性能

    我们有理由相信,在未来的版本中,Hyper-V 将能够更有效地解决键盘无响应等类似问题,为用户提供更加稳定、可靠和高效的虚拟化解决方案

     结语 Hyper-V 键盘无响应的问题虽然令人头疼,但并非无法解决

    通过仔细分析问题成因、尝试多种解决方案以及采取必要的预防措施,用户完全有能力克服这一挑战并充分利用 Hyper-V 平台提供的强大功能

    让我们携手共进,共同推动虚拟化技术的发展和创新!